From Wikipedia – “Kim’s mother would take her own life four months after the fight. The bout’s referee, Richard Green, committed suicide July 1, 1983.

Day of the fight – Sun, Moon, Mercury, Venus and Jupiter in Scorpio. Mars in Capricorn and Saturn and Pluto conjunct.
